The Breeding Method and Precautions of Jingzhi Hua jin
The Jingzhi Hua jin with leaves that shine with a jade-like luster is a highly ornamental variety in the succulent family. Its unique brocade pattern is both a visual focus and an indicator of the difficulty of care. Many plant enthusiasts often encounter issues like fading brocade and excessive growth during cultivation, but by mastering three core care principles, this "living art piece" can maintain its astonishing state for a long time.
Environmental Control: Creating a Growth Bed for Brocade Patterns
Substrate Proportion Golden Rule
The vermiculite content should be controlled within 20%, combined with 40% red jade soil and 40% peat to form a "breathing-type substrate." This structure can prevent waterlogging and root rot while the slow-release characteristic of red jade soil continuously supplies nutrients. It is recommended to mix in 5% bamboo charcoal particles during potting in spring every year to effectively prevent root diseases.
Balance of Light and Shadow Art
Use the "curtain filtering method" to control light intensity, with double-layer shading nets reducing 60% of UV rays in summer. Ensuring 4 hours of direct sunlight in winter can make the brocade pattern display an amber gradient. When the outer leaves begin to curl slightly, immediately adjust the distance between the plant and the light source.
Water Management: Key to Activating Brocade Patterns
Seasonal Watering Rhythm
In spring and autumn, use the "soaking + spraying" dual-track supplement method, soaking once every Tuesday, Thursday, and Saturday, with the water level not exceeding 1/3 of the pot height each time. In summer and winter, use a narrow-mouthed pot to water along the pot wall, keeping the substrate moisture content around 30%. The recommended air humidity is between 55%-65%.
Water Quality Selection Skills
Mixing rainwater and pure water in a 1:3 ratio can significantly improve the clarity of the brocade pattern. Tap water needs to be left to stand for 48 hours and add 2 drops of lemon acid to adjust the pH value to 6.2-6.5. In winter, the water temperature should be no more than 3°C different from the room temperature to avoid cold stimulation.
Special Period Care Strategies
Summer Protection System
When the temperature exceeds 32°C, initiate the "three-stop principle": stop fertilizing, stop repotting, and stop leaf surface watering. Laying volcanic stone particles on the surface of the potting soil can reduce the temperature around the roots by 3-5°C. Combined with a mini circulating fan, ensure at least 6 hours of ventilation per day.
Brocade Pattern Strengthening Plan
When the brocade pattern on new leaves fades, use the "stepwise lighting supplement method": add 20 minutes of scattered light every day in the first week, and introduce morning direct sunlight in the second week. Also apply a special fertilizer containing trace rare earth elements once a month for three months to see an effect.
Through precise light control and water management, the brocade pattern of Jingzhi Hua jin can maintain its ornamental value for 3-5 years. It is recommended to take growth record photos every quarter and adjust the care plan in time based on changes in leaf expansion and brocade pattern distribution.
